Posted

Nice to have picture books but be prepared for to diagnose pests and diseases, these two are crucial for serious growers.

"ORNAMENTAL PALMS in HORTICULTURE" by Tim Broschat

"ORNAMENTAL PALM DISEASES AND DISORDERS" by the American Phytopathological Society

The new edition of Riffle & Craft will be Riffle, Craft & Zona, and it's coming out in summer, 2012: Encyclopedia of Cultivated Palms, 2nd Edition
